I've got an older generator with a 3-prong 240V outlet on it. L6-30R

My house has a bypass panel installed with 4-pin 240V plug on it.
L14-30P

I need to make an adapter cable.

So at the generator I have the two hots and a ground. At the house I
have two hots, ground, and a neutral.

Do I tape off the neutral, or bug it to the ground at the generator
end of the adapter cable?


Your existing twist lok, is 30 amp 240 volt, plus ground. You need 30
amp 120/240, plus ground. Replace the existing twist lok with an L14-30
using the existing wires, and add a neutral, which will be going to the
120 volt receptacles on the machine
